Baby Vanessa: Mills wants his mom to raise girl
DAYTON — The father of Baby Vanessa says his mother is willing to raise his daughter, according to a statement released by his attorney Monday, July 26.
Benjamin Mills, 39, of Dayton maintains that he never consented to the adoption of Vanessa, who lives with her adoptive mother, Stacey Doss, 45, in California. Mills has three children with Andrea Conley, 31, who lives in Riverside. Conley supports Doss’ efforts to finalize the adoption.
Mills’ mother, Rena Jordan, has had legal custody of Mills’ two other children with Conley since 2008, according to the statement released by Legal Aid of Western Ohio attorney Elizabeth Gorman, who represents Mills.
That statement also quotes Cristy Oakes, who represents Jordan. Oakes’ statement identifies Jordan as a retired school teacher.
“At this time, Ms. Jordan is ready, willing and able to take custody of her granddaughter,” Oakes said. “She wants to raise her granddaughter with her two siblings in a loving, caring environment.
Gorman said that Mills wants to start a relationship with Vanessa and to bond with her family. She also said that Mills and Jordan both believe that “the custody issues involving their daughter and granddaughter are private and should be resolved in the court and not in the media.”
